Transaction bf6f04428644950befbe8fe582592b49b62a75bf2898fc095055b78bda02b70d
1 Input
1 Output
-
bf6f04428644950befbe8fe582592b49b62a75bf2898fc095055b78bda02b70d:0
- value
- 658106
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8ffd3a29574498eaf01795930bbfbd4aa4a5127 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NEzEf1eJyhYBJrKfmEPF35ByeA25NKj9p